Vertical Tab Strip by N2010
A product of boredom. Basically, this is a row of vertical tabs. Maybe they're buttons. Who knows? I certainly don't!

To use/run this, you'll need to grab Animating Fields and Color Class. The latter is just determining whether light or dark text is better suited for a particular tab.



This was mostly made just so I could mess around with the animation code I wrote a while back. Over the course of a few hours I've just been fiddling with adding bits and pieces to it - the test code probably equates to a castle of beach balls built atop a rickety bridge, but the tabstrip itself is pretty solid, I think.
